In 1998, Kristi Anderson survived a random violent crime when a serial attacker hid inside her apartment and brutally attacked her after she returned from walking her dog. Surviving that night began a lifelong journey of rebuilding, understanding trauma, and learning how people can reduce risk without living in fear.
Kristi holds a Bachelor of Science degree in Psychology and has spent more than 25 years studying personal safety and crime prevention, human behavior, criminal behavior and patterns, property security, post-traumatic stress, and the long-term realities survivors face after violent crime. Her professional experience spans sports management, senior healthcare sales, and property management, providing a broad perspective on leadership, communication, risk reduction, and protecting people in a variety of environments. She also gained extensive firsthand exposure to the criminal justice system through longstanding personal relationships within the District Attorney's Office, including those assigned to homicide cases. This provided valuable insight into criminal investigations, prosecutions, trials, and the judicial system.
In Kristi's case, the attacker was initially sentenced to two life terms for attempted first-degree murder and burglary. He also received additional sentences for crimes committed against two other victims. Those convictions were later overturned on appeal, and he accepted a plea agreement for 30 years. He was released in 2024 after serving 26 years in prison and remains under conditional release supervision until early 2029. At that time, he will be free.
